On next week's episode of Teen Mom, we'll get a closer look at Catelynn Lowell's emotional adoption support group session.
In the sneak peek clip, Catelynn reveals that she placed her daughter Carly up for adoption about two and a half years ago. She also tells the group that her mother did not support or agree with her decision to choose adoption.
Luckily, Catelynn has her grandmother Deb, who has been her rock throughout the past few years. Although Deb grew attached to little Carly almost immediately, she understands and supports Catelynn's decision.
Although she's content with her choice, Catelynn admits that talking about her daughter isn't easy. She tears up when she recalls the moment she said goodbye to Carly.
"I really felt like I was falling apart," she says.
But now, Catelynn is in a much better place, thanks to some new friendships with the women in her support group.
